    CORE26 | U.S. Navy Medical Teams Test Next-Generation Patient Tracking Tech in the Arctic

    From left, U.S. Navy Lt. Erik Myers, a physician assistant with 2nd Battalion, 6th Marine Regiment, 2nd Marine Division; Lt. Katy Davis, a family medicine physician; and Hospital Corpsman 1st Class William Ivey, an Independent Duty Corpsman, use an Operational Medicine Care Delivery Platform in Setermoen, Norway, March 8, 2026. The training, part of exercise Cold Response 26, allowed the medical team to test the new platform, which is designed to improve decision support and trauma documentation in low-resource environments. A key component of NATO's enhanced vigilance activity Arctic Sentry, exercise Cold Response 26 is a Norwegian-led winter military exercise designed to enhance collective defense capabilities and ensure U.S. readiness to rapidly deploy and seamlessly operate alongside NATO Allies in challenging arctic conditions. (U.S. Marine Corps photo by Cpl. Michael Bartman)
